Djensen,

Is there any way you could tell me how much space this forum's database takes up on your server? The reason I ask is becuase I'm considering implementing one in my website, and I need to estimate how much space I should allot for it. Even an educated guess would be appreciated... Tongue

P.S.: Am I correct in assuming it's MySQL?

As of this morning the database is taking up 78919787 bytes. That would be 75MB. That is for a medium amount of posting and not purging any messages.

There are several bulletin board forum software packages out there. I just happen to use phpBB. Most all of them support the popular free DBs such as MySql and Postgresql. Postgresql is supior to MySql because it supports stored functions and transaction rollbacks.
